Abstract
The present invention relates to a kind of natural gas well constant pressure throttling apparatus, the constant pressure throttling apparatus includes shell and the piston that can move reciprocatingly in shell, described piston one end is connected with elastic device, the elastic device is fixed on spring limiting part, the other end of the piston, which is equipped with, to be open and is limited by piston limit part, corresponding position is equipped with the metering hole penetrated through with natural gas line to the shell on the outer periphery respectively with piston, and the metering hole passes through the inner cavity of piston and the open communication of piston.The size of automatic adjustment throttling set gas nozzle may be implemented in the present invention, realizes constant pressure throttling, reduces labor intensity, reduce costs, improve work efficiency.

Background technique
In traditional gas exploitation course, the pressure in gas well well is higher, it is necessary in well head installation reducing pressure by regulating flow dress
The gas production for setting control gas well, can be only achieved the purpose of steady production.During reducing pressure by regulating flow, natural gas passes through flow nipple
Later pressure reduces rapidly, and volume increases sharply, therewith the also rapid drawdown of the temperature of natural gas, and usually all containing certain in natural gas
The moisture of ratio when natural gas temperature drops to the formation condition of hydrate, will condense hydrate, and hydrate will cause ground and set
Standby blocking influences the normal production of the natural gas well.As Authorization Notice No. is CN203540770U, authorized announcement date is
2014.04.16 Chinese utility model patent provides a kind of valve type air valve device, which includes valve body, valve
Intracoelomic cavity is divided into epicoele and cavity of resorption, and epicoele is intracavitary under to be equipped with gear shaft, and gear shaft is equipped with gear, passes through chain between gear
Item transmission connection, gas nozzle are fixed on chain, and gas nozzle component is overhauled and replaced by gear drive chain after blocking,
And the apparatus structure is complex, needs to manually check in use and replaces gas nozzle component manually, influences manufacturing schedule, reduce
Efficiency.
For this purpose, recent domestic develops downhole choke technology, above-mentioned surface throttling mode is transferred to downhole choke, benefit
With underground itself hot environment, throttling, decompression, expansion, cooling and the endothermic process of natural gas are completed, improves natural gas decompression section
Outlet temperature after stream improves gas well yield to prevent hydrate frozen block.And flow controller used at present is mostly fixed gas nozzle
Flow controller, it is necessary to which different grades of throttle power is realized with taking pulling operation to replace various sizes of flow nipple by closing well
Can, so that natural gas well yield can not be adjusted in time, manufacturing schedule is influenced, increases operating cost and risk.

Specific embodiment
Embodiments of the present invention are described further with reference to the accompanying drawing.
The specific embodiment one of natural gas well constant pressure throttling apparatus of the invention, as shown in Figure 1, a kind of natural gas well constant pressure
Throttling set, including shell 4, piston 5,3 three parts of balance weight.The left and right ends of shell 4 are equipped with threaded hole, on the threaded hole of left end
Equipped with the pressure spring locating part 1 for connecting pressure spring 2, right end threaded hole is equipped with the piston limit for being limited to piston rod
Part 7, pressure spring locating part 1 and 7 collective effect of piston limit part move to guarantee that piston rod can be moved back and forth without departing from it
Range.The position corresponding with the upper side of piston 5 of shell 4 is equipped with metering hole 9, metering hole 9 and natural gas air inlet pipe line 11
Air inlet 10 is connected to, and metering hole 9 changes the size of opening, and then change day by reciprocating movement of the piston 5 shell 4 inside
Right gas enters the flow of 5 inner cavity of piston, plays the role of current limliting.The inner cavity of piston 5 passes through the piston limit part 7 of right end and goes out
Port 8 is connected to, and to guarantee that natural-gas can be discharged timely, the both ends of metering hole 9 are equipped with sealing ring 6, natural to guarantee
Gas does not diffuse into 4 left end of shell after flowing into metering hole 9 and 5 inner cavity of piston and leaks out.The piston rod of 5 left end of piston
12 are connected by the pilot hole 13 on baffle with the groove 14 on balance weight 3, and pressure spring 2,13 He of pilot hole are connected on balance weight 3
Groove 14 all plays positioning and guiding to piston rod, makes piston rod 12 will not run-off the straight and radial direction turn in reciprocatory movement
It is dynamic, be also prevented from piston rod 12 because stress it is excessive caused by be broken.
Specifically, in embodiment, when work, the natural gas in gas well flows into piston by the air inlet 10 of admission line 11
5 with the metering hole 9 of 4 upper side of shell, it is identical as 8 gas pressure of gas outlet in air inlet 10 hence into the inner cavity of piston 5
When, piston 5 is aligned with the metering hole 9 of 4 upper side of shell and is connected to, and pore size is identical, and opening is maximum at this time, piston 5
The elastic force of suffered gas pressure and pressure spring 2 reaches balance.Gas when the gas discharge of gas well increases, at air inlet 10
Pressure rises, while pressure suffered by 5 intracavity section of piston just will increase, and the piston rod 12 on piston 5 will under pressure
It can be moved to the left and push balance weight 3,3 compression press spring 2 of balance weight, phase will occur for piston 5 and the metering hole 9 of 4 upper side of shell
To displacement, reduce the opening of metering hole 9, generates chock pressure difference, so that the inner chamber gas pressure of piston 5 reduces, outlet
Pressure also declines therewith.When the gas discharge of gas well reduces, the gas pressure at air inlet 10 declines, while in piston 5
Pressure suffered by chamber section will reduce, and move right in the elastic force effect lower piston 5 of pressure spring 2, piston 5 and 4 upper side of shell
Metering hole 9 relative displacement will occur, increase the opening of metering hole 9, so that the outlet pressure of gas outlet 8 increases.Pass through
The elastic force collective effect of 5 inner chamber gas pressure of piston and pressure spring 2 makes piston 5 ceaselessly automatically adjust the openings of sizes of metering hole 9,
So that outlet pressure consistently achieves balance, to realize the purpose of constant pressure.
